The Importance Of Monitoring Core Body Temperature With A Core Body Temp Monitor

Core body temperature is a key physiological parameter that can provide valuable insights into a person’s health and well-being. Monitoring core body temperature can help detect early signs of illness, track the progress of a fever, and optimize athletic performance. In recent years, advances in technology have made it easier than ever to monitor core body temperature with the use of a core body temp monitor.

A core body temp monitor is a device that measures the internal temperature of the body. Unlike traditional thermometers that measure skin temperature, core body temp monitors are designed to provide a more accurate and reliable reading of the body’s internal temperature. These devices can be worn continuously to track changes in core body temperature over time, making them useful tools for both medical professionals and athletes.

There are several types of core body temp monitors available on the market, ranging from wearable devices to ingestible sensors. Wearable core body temp monitors are often worn as a patch or band on the skin and can provide real-time data on core body temperature. These devices are convenient for everyday use and can be easily integrated into daily activities.

Ingestible core body temp monitors, on the other hand, are small sensors that are swallowed and pass through the digestive system. Once ingested, these sensors transmit data on core body temperature wirelessly to a smartphone or other device. While ingestible sensors may not be suitable for all individuals, they can be a valuable tool for tracking core body temperature in certain situations, such as during athletic competitions or medical procedures.
